It is possible to receive L-1 standing as the single proprietor or majority investor in your firm. To do this, you will have to be hired as an employee of the business (CHIEF EXECUTIVE OFFICER, as an moved here example), and your transfer will have to be authorized by your business's board of supervisors.


You might need the help of a law office that is totally acquainted with. To sponsor an L-1 visa for a short-term worker, the sponsoring company has to: Enjoy a "qualifying relationship" with a business that is established and doing business under the laws of an international territory (the race of the business's owners is normally pointless); and Currently be operating as an US employer (or, in the case of a new workplace, preparing to do business), either directly or through a 'certifying company'.


The United States enroller must continue satisfying the foregoing qualifications throughout of the visa beneficiary's stay. "Doing organization" suggests earning income through the stipulation of products and solutions on a normal, organized basis. A mere official presence abroad, such as a representative workplace, is insufficient. Dimension issues business with fewer than five employees are unlikely Learn More Here to be thought about eligible to sponsor an L-1 visa staff member.


2 business are affiliates if the exact same business, specific or group of people has and regulates both of them. A category is one of the two types of L1 visas available (the other type is called an L-1B visa).

An international firm that intends to establish an US office can additionally send out a supervisor or exec to the United States to establish a new workplace.


Develops policies, procedures and objectives for the business. Delights in the discernment to make executive-level choices, either within the firm or on part of the firm's ventures with 3rd celebrations.


One of the key benefits of the L1A visa is the ability to send a qualifying employee to the United States to establish a brand-new office. To do this, the funding company needs to: Prove that it has actually currently acquired the physical facilities to develop the brand-new office. his comment is here This is generally accomplished with ownership or lease of physical residential property.


Show that it possesses the financial means to begin service operations and to pay the employee throughout his whole period of keep. If a parent firm is developing the brand-new workplace, for instance, a resolution from the board of directors pledging adequate funding can be used (assuming that the parent firm's funds are enough).
